vim mysql.sh
#!/bin/bash
day=`date +%y-%m-%d` //日期以年月日顯示並賦予day變數
size=`du -sh /var/lib/mysql //檢視mysql的大小並且賦予變數size
echo "date :$day" >> /tmp/mysqlbak.txt //輸出日期到mysqlbak.txt檔案
echo "date size : $size" >> /tmp/mysqlbak.txt //輸出檔案大小到mysqlbak.txt檔案
cd /tmp/mysql //切換到mysql目錄下
tar zcvf mysqlbak-$.tar.gz /var/lib/mysql /tmp/mysqlbak.txt //打包mysql資料庫檔案和日期大小檔案
rm -rf /tmp/mysql.txt //刪除mysqlbak.txt存放mysql資料大小檔案
MySQL資料庫備份指令碼
1.指令碼內容 單獨的指令碼 bin sh if 4 then echo usage 0 db host db user db pwd db name exit fiprefix date y m d h m s filepath root dbbackup date y m 4 prefix if...
mysql資料庫備份指令碼
第一步 編寫資料庫備份指令碼database mysql shell.sh bin bash date date y m d h m every minute database springboot admin database name db username root database user...
備份MySQL資料庫指令碼
備份mysql資料庫中 mysql 庫 規定每週日24點備份 root mysql vim root mysqldump.sh bin bash backup database mysql owner weijia date 2019 04 13 mysql user root 登入使用者 mysq...